#9ACFAB Hex color

#9ACFAB

The hexadecimal color code #9ACFAB corresponds to the code RGB( 154, 207, 171 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,60 level), green (at 0,81 level) and blue (at 0,67 level). Its brightness is 70% and its saturation is 35%. It is composed of red at 28%, green at 38% and blue at 32%.
